Where else can you find a golf course and campground combo?In the campground there are plenty of power and water hookups for travel trailers or tents ($15/night), a primitive camping area, a couple large shelter areas with large built in grills, plenty of picnic tables and vault toilets. Overall a very clean campground.There is also a public 9 hole golf course with sand greens on the property. All of the greens have the necessary tools needed to smooth putting lanes and reset the sand for the next golfers. Good yardage on the fairways - there is even a water hazard on one hole. The green fee is only $2. No clubhouse so bring your own beer and cart. - Brandon Hirsch

Buckley Creek Recreation Area is well-equipped with a variety of services designed to enhance your camping experience, whether you prefer modern conveniences or a more primitive approach.

  • Power and Water Hookups: The campground offers plenty of sites with both power and water hookups, catering to travel trailers and even tents for those who prefer powered sites. This is a significant convenience, allowing campers to run appliances, charge devices, and have easy access to water. The cost for these sites is a very reasonable $15 per night.

  • Primitive Camping Area: For those who prefer a more rustic experience, there is also a designated primitive camping area. This allows tent campers or those with self-contained RVs to enjoy a simpler, more immersed experience in nature.

  • Shelter Areas with Grills: The recreation area features a couple of large shelter areas, perfect for group gatherings, family picnics, or simply escaping the sun or light rain. These shelters are equipped with large, built-in charcoal grills that are highly praised by visitors for their quality and ease of use, including awesome lids and ash clean-out features.

  • Picnic Tables: Throughout the campground and recreation area, you will find plenty of picnic tables, providing designated spots for outdoor meals, games, or simply relaxing.

  • Vault Toilets: Clean and well-maintained vault toilets are available, offering essential sanitation facilities for all campers. These facilities are noted to be nicely maintained and looked recently repainted, ensuring a pleasant experience.

  • Drinking Water: While specific hookups are mentioned, general public information for Buckley Creek indicates the availability of drinking water, likely at central spigots or via the site-specific water hookups.

  • Public 9-Hole Golf Course with Sand Greens: The property features a public 9-hole golf course with traditional sand greens. This offers a charming, old-school golfing experience. Crucially, all greens are equipped with the necessary tools for smoothing putting lanes and resetting the sand, ensuring a playable and enjoyable round. The green fee is exceptionally affordable at only $2, making it an accessible activity for everyone. Reviewers note good yardage on the fairways and even a water hazard, adding to the challenge.
